The 8th Congress of the Labor Party, the largest political event in North Korea, marks the week of opening.
Chosun Central News Agency reported on the news of the 6th meeting held the day before the 11th, and reported “the meeting continues”, and it seems that the meeting continued on that day.
At the previous day’s meeting, elections were held for the party’s central leadership, including the appointment of Kim Jong-un as the Labor Party’s general secretary, and the first plenary meeting of the 8th Central Committee was held.
Prior to this, the Central Inspection Committee of the Party has already completed the project consolidation and revision of the Party’s rules. General Secretary Kim Jong-un made a report on the business summary for three days on the 5th to 7th, and the representative discussion continued on the 8th to 9th.
The remainder of the agenda for this conference is about the adoption of the Central Committee’s business consolidation decision, so there is a possibility that Secretary General Kim will declare the closing within a day or two.
Compared to the four-day schedule of the 7th Party Congress in 2016, the schedule is already twice as long.
North Korea held the 5th Party Congress in 1970 over a total of 12 days. The 3rd-4th Congress held in 1956 and 1961 lasted for 7 and 8 days respectively.
In particular, the possibility of reducing the party conference schedule this time due to the prevention of novel coronavirus infection (Corona 19) was predicted, but rather, thousands of people are spending about a week at the conference hall without masks.
Some observers say that the meeting held for a week without wearing a mask while Chairman Kim Jong-un was present is a circumvention of North Korea’s confidence in the fight against Corona 19.
On the other hand, attention is also paid to whether North Korea conducted a feverish ceremony in the severe cold, where the minimum temperature in Pyongyang reached minus 14 degrees Celsius.
In the morning of that day, the Joint Chiefs of Staff announced that North Korea had caught the situation in which North Korea held a party conference-related parade on the late night of the 10th.
On October 10 last year, on October 10th, on the 75th anniversary of the founding of the Labor Party, there is a precedent that North Korea held a’late night fever ceremony’ from midnight.
At that time, the North Korean broadcaster delivered the appearance of a fever by means of a recording broadcast from 7 pm.
